Negativity gets us nowhere,
Our attitude, our choice,
We can view our blessings
Or grumble with our voice.
The clouds may still be present,
May nag our every step,
With Jesus as our focus
Our hearts know we are kept.
In complaining lies ingratitude,
A victim we become
To Satan's darts of fear and doubt
Until God's kingdom comes.
God's children know their future,
It's temporary here.
Rejoicing and thanksgiving
Will rout those darts of fear.
God's grooming us for better things,
Of this we can be sure,
Preparing us for what's ahead
In His hands we're secure.
Our bitterness a habit,
It's far past time to break.
And bitterness can oft repel
The friends we hope to make.
Our spirits filled with sunshine
Oft magnets then become,
A draw to friends and neighbors,
A witness then to some.
For nothing matters more on earth
Than leading souls to Him,
And spirits filled with sunshine
Will cause the clouds to dim.
A thankfulness develops
For His great gift of love,
The enemy's attacks on us
We then can rise above.
"I know how to be abased and live humbly in straitened circumstances, and I know also how to enjoy plenty and live in abundance. I have learned in any and all circumstances, the secret of facing every situation, whether well-fed or going hungry, having a sufficiency and to spare or going without and being in want.
I have strength for all things in Christ Who empowers me--I am ready for anything and equal to anything through Him Who infuses inner strength into me, (that is, I am self-sufficient in Christ's sufficiency.)" Philippians 4:12-13
